When I was a Steward at Home Park there was a system of Pink Notes. Similar to a Yellow Card, the Pink Note would act as a Warning, if they continued then they were out.

This was about 10 years ago, so more than likely changed since then. The Pink Notes were quite successful though, people who were given them were told CCTV was on them etc, ...they got the message in the end and majority of the time stopped chanting offensive chants.
